Reni-Giurgiulesti Checkpoint Reconstruction Meeting: Enhancing Border Traffic Capacity

(Photo: Recovery and Development Service)

An offsite working meeting was held at the Reni - Giurgiulesti border crossing point for road traffic to discuss further actions towards the implementation of measures to reconstruct the checkpoint and arrange a parking lot near the checkpoint.

This was reported by the Infrastructure Restoration and Development Service in Odesa Oblast.

The meeting was attended by Oleksandr Kabachynskyi, Deputy Head of International Cooperation and Border Infrastructure Development of the Restoration Service in Odesa Oblast , Alan Baron, representative of the European Union Directorate-General for Mobility and Transport (DG MOVE), representatives of the EUBAM - EU Border Assistance Mission to Moldova and Ukraine and representatives of the State Border Guard and Customs Services of Ukraine and the Republic of Moldova.

Each of the participants of the meeting received information about the further action plan for the reconstruction of the checkpoint and the construction of a site near it.

This is not the first reconstruction of the checkpoint in Reni. In 2024, the work doubled the throughput capacity. At that time, separate lanes were provided for trucks and buses at the checkpoint, which will reduce the time for passengers to cross the border.

During the reconstruction, three floors and the facade of the administrative building were renovated, and sanitary facilities at the checkpoint were updated.

In addition, the road surface was replaced, and road signs and information boards were updated and installed. The repairs were carried out by the Infrastructure Restoration and Development Service in Odesa Oblast.
